Named data networking (NDN) is a network layer protocol that aims to replace the IP layer in the current Internet architecture. Currently, e-mails are sent from one mail server to another by identifying each server by its IP address. In this paper, we propose to develop an e-mail application that runs on NDN. The challenge in developing an e-mail application on NDN is to completely abandon the usage of IP addresses and concentrate on the ‘content’ to be sent or received. We intend to send a mail from sender’s computer to receiver’s computer over NDN.We propose to adapt the protocols used in e-mail transfer such as SMTP and POP to suit the characteristics of NDN.
